/* CSS Document */

body{
background-color:#2D77BE;
margin:0px;
font-size:12px;
font-family:Arial, Helvetica, sans-serif;
}

h1{
color:#2D77BE;
display:block;
font-size:14px;
}

h2{
color:#2D77BE;
display:block;
border-bottom:1px solid #CCCCCC;
font-size:12px;
}

h3{
color:#000000;
font-size:12px;
}

#banner1{
background-image:url(images/banner1.jpg);
width:929px;
height:261px;
margin:auto;
}

#banne2{
background-image:url(images/banner2.jpg);
width:929px;
height:78px;
margin:auto;
}

#page-bg{
background-image:url(images/page-bg.jpg);
width:929px;
margin:auto;
}

#contents{
width:810px;
margin:auto;
}

#left{
width:250px;
float:left;
color:#FFFFFF;
margin-right:19px;
}

#left li,ul{
list-style-type:none;
text-align:right;
padding-bottom:8px;
}

#left li a{
color:#FFFFFF;
font-size:16px;
text-decoration:none;
font-weight:bold;
}

#left-inside{
margin:auto;
padding:20px;
}

.callusnow{
font-size:16px;
font-weight:bold;
}

.phonenumber{
font-size:22px;
}

#right{
width:520px;
float:left;
margin-left:20px;
}

#right-inside{
margin:auto;
padding:20px;
}

#footer-top{
background-image:url(images/footer-top.jpg);
width:929px;
height:20px;
margin:auto;
}

#footer-bg{
background-image:url(images/footerbg.jpg);
width:929px;
margin:auto;
font-size:11px;
}

#footer-bg a{
color:#333333;
text-decoration:none;
}

#footer-bg a:hover{
text-decoration:underline;
color:#2D77BE;
}

#footer-left{
width:260px;
float:left;
margin-left:53px;
color:#FFFFFF;
}

#footer-left-inside{
margin:auto;
padding:20px;
}

#footer-right{
width:550px;
float:left;
margin-left:20px;
}

#footer-right-inside{
margin:auto;
padding:20px;
}

.red{
font-weight:bold;
}